The F3 Controller provides Active Burst Mode to reach the lowest Standby Power Requirements <100mW at no load.
As the controller is always active during Active Burst Mode, there is an immediate response on load jumps without any black out in the SMPS. In Active Burst Mode the ripple of the output voltage can be reduced <1%.
Furthermore, to increase the robustness and safety of the system, the device enters into Auto Restart Mode in the cases of Overtemperature, VCC Overvoltage, Output Open Loop or Overload and VCC Undervoltage. By means of the internal precise peak current limitation, the dimension of the transformer and the secondary diode can be lowered which leads to more cost efficiency. An adjustable blanking window prevents the IC from entering Auto Restart Mode or Active Burst Mode unintentionally in case of high load jumps.

ICE3BS02 Features
· Active Burst Mode for lowest Standby Power @ light load controlled by Feedback Signal · Fast load jump response in Active Burst Mode · 500V Startup Cell switched off after Start Up · 100/67kHz internally fixed switching frequency · Auto Restart Mode for Overtemperature Detection · Auto Restart Mode for VCC Overvoltage Detection · Auto Restart Mode for Overload and Open Loop · Auto Restart Mode for VCC Undervoltage · Blanking Window for short duration high current · User defined Soft Start · Minimum of external components required · Max Duty Cycle 72% · Overall tolerance of Current Limiting < ±5% · Internal PWM Leading Edge Blanking · Soft switching for low EMI

ICE3BS02L General Description
The F3 Controller provides Active Burst Mode to reach the lowest Standby Power Requirements <100mW at no load. As the controller is always active during Active Burst Mode, there is an immediate response on load jumps without any black out in the SMPS. In Active Burst Mode the ripple of the output voltage can be reduced <1%. Furthermore, to increase the robustness and safety of the system, the device enters into Latched Off Mode in the cases of Overtemperature,Overvoltage or Short Winding. The Latched Off Mode can only be reset by disconnecting the main line. Auto Restart Mode is entered for cases like open loop or overload. By means of an internal precise peak current limitation, the dimension of the transformer and the secondary diode can be lowered which leads to more cost efficiency. An adjustable blanking window prevents the IC from entering Auto Restart Mode or Active Burst Mode unintentionally in case of high load jumps.
